Property Details

Tucked away down a landscaped path, this stand-alone townhouse with 3 bedrooms and 2 full baths pairs its private setting with 2 distinct outdoor spaces. One the main level, the sun-lit adobe features an open floor plan w/spacious living rm anchored... by a fireplace, dining area, well-appointed kitchen and a sizable deck for outdoor entertaining. Upstairs, 2 generous BRs & a full bath occupy the 2nd floor, while the top level is a private fireplaced primary suite w/en-suite bath, large closet & its own secluded deck. Central air. Ideally located in the Central-Inman-Kendall triangle, this home offers rare seclusion just moments from two Red Line stops, MIT, and Harvard
